When prompted, select the drive that Windows is on (usually the C: drive). … WebSep 22, 2024 · D3DSCache is a folder that contains cached information for Microsoft's Direct3D API. This is part of DirectX, which is used for graphics display in games and other visually intensive software. WebMar 6, 2024 · In general terms, a cache (pronounced "cash") is a type of repository. You can think of a repository as a storage depot. In the military, this would be to hold weapons, food, and other supplies needed to carry forward a mission. In computer science, these "supplies" are termed resources, where the resources are scripts, code, and document content. WebHow to clear the temporary files cache on Windows 10 using Disk Cleanup. 1.
